The Taiwan Affairs Office of the Chinese State Council denounced on Sunday the United States' decision to provide $345 million in military aid to Taiwan. The package includes drones, air defense systems, missiles, and military education and training, among others.
"Such move is turning Taiwan into a 'powder keg' and an 'ammunition depot,' escalating the risk of military conflict across the Taiwan Straits," the office said, according to China's Global Times. It warned Taiwan's ruling Democratic Progressive Party that, "if it continues down this path unimpeded, the young generation can only become cannon fodder."
